ARISTEGUI, Roberto et al. Towards a Pedagogy of Coexistence. Psykhe [online]. 2005, vol.14, n.1, pp.137-150. ISSN 0718-2228.  http://dx.doi.org/10.4067/S0718-22282005000100011.

The present document constitutes a first approximation for the formulation in theoric, conceptual and operational terms, of a form of teaching destined to give answer to the great problem that today represents the coexistence in the school. Tentatively it incorporates the expression Pedagogy of Coexistence, to give account of this effort. Mainly, it aims to put the bases for future socioeducative interventions oriented to transform the school into a critical and harmonious community, able to assume the breakdowns and communication problems, as both resources and opportunities, with the objective to construct a coexistence illuminated from the diversity and mutual comprehension. It is structured in three sections: Pretext and Context of Coexistence in the School, Coexistence as a Complex Social Construction, and Towards a Pedagogy of Coexistence.

Keywords : school community; coexistence; pedagogy.
